What possessions were found with ice mans what conclusions can the archaeologist make?
The possessions found with the Iceman include a copper axe, a quiver with arrows, a knife, and various personal items like clothing and tools. From these items, archaeologists can infer details about the Iceman's lifestyle, diet, and the technology/tools used during his time. Additionally, the presence of these well-preserved artifacts provides valuable insights into the Copper Age period in which the Iceman lived.

Why do archaeologist use tiny paint brushes?
Because a backhoe would damage the stuff they're trying to dig up.
Archaeologists use a number of tools. If they think the surface layer is thick, they might actually use a backhoe, but more generally they'll use shovels and picks to remove the surface layers. When they get down to the interesting layers, they will switch to smaller spades, or trowels. To remove the dirt without damaging the artifact, they'll use brushes, and smaller brushes, and finally tiny brushes to dislodge the dirt.
The key point is, they don't want to damage the artifact.
Why do archaeologists use trowel?
Archaeologists use trowels to carefully excavate and sift through soil layers in order to uncover artifacts and features without damaging them. Trowels are also useful for detailed work in tight spaces and for creating clean, straight walls in excavation units.

What are founded the first Indian empire?
The Maurya Empire was the first Indian empire, founded by Chandragupta Maurya in 322 BCE. It was one of the largest and most powerful empires in ancient India, with its capital at Pataliputra (modern-day Patna).

What process aids an archaeologist in the study of artifacts?
One process that aids archaeologists in the study of artifacts is stratigraphy, which involves analyzing the layers in which artifacts are found to determine their relative ages. This helps to establish a chronological sequence of events at a particular site. Analysis of artifacts' material composition, style, and context also provides valuable information about past societies and cultures.
To help them analyze a site archeologists make?
To help analyze a site, archaeologists make detailed maps, take photographs, record measurements, and create sketches of artifacts and features found. They also conduct excavation, conduct laboratory analysis, and consult historical records and literature to interpret their findings. Additionally, they collaborate with specialists in fields such as botany, geology, and chemistry to gain a comprehensive understanding of the site.

When did archaeologists find evidence of clovis people in America?
Archaeologists found evidence of Clovis people in America dating back to approximately 13,000 years ago, making them some of the earliest known inhabitants of the continent. The Clovis culture is known for their distinctive stone tools, such as fluted spear points, which have been found at various archaeological sites across North America.

How did archaeologist's become aware of the existence of Nok people?
Archaeologists became aware of the existence of the Nok people through the discovery of terracotta figurines and other artifacts in central Nigeria in the 1920s. These artifacts provided evidence of a sophisticated ancient culture that thrived in the region between 500 BC and 200 AD. Subsequent excavations and research have helped illuminate the cultural and artistic achievements of the Nok people.
